Sec. 2272. Destruction of vessel by owner

    Whoever, upon the high seas or on any other waters within the 
admiralty and maritime jurisdiction of the United States, willfully and 
corruptly casts away or otherwise destroys any vessel of which he is 
owner, in whole or in part, with intent to injure any person that may 
underwrite any policy of insurance thereon, or any merchant that may 
have goods thereon, or any other
